To be honest dean - I think you have "a mess" of different plants :D
Hyg. polusperma 'rosanervig', for sure (pic. 2)
Hyg. polysperma ( pic. 1 and 3)

If you only ever put Hyg. polysperma 'rosanervig' in this tank.....then what has happened is, your 'rosanervig' has grown branches, that have fallen back to standard polysperma.
This happens (often!!) because the 'rosanervig' is a variation of standard polysperma.......and not very stabil, actually.
